Sanofi Pasteur Plans to Buy VaxDesign for $60 Million

William Warren | Via Orlando Business Journal | October 11, 2010

French pharmaceutical giant Sanofi Pasteur plans to buy Orlando-based biotech company VaxDesign in a $60 million deal, which will bring the presence of a major international pharmaceutical company to Central Florida.
In addition, VaxDesign plans to nearly double the size of its facility in the next three or four months and add another 17 high-wage jobs within the next 12 months.
Lyon, France-based Sanofi Pasteur, the vaccines division of Sanofi-Aventis Group (NYSE: SNY), is the largest company in the world devoted entirely to human vaccines.
Sanofi Pasteur signed a binding agreement on Sept. 27 for the acquisition of VaxDesign, which develops, makes and markets in vitro models of the human immune system. The deal is expected to close by the end of the year.
